Yasir Shah took six wickets to steer Pakistan to a 133-run win over the West Indies in the second Test in Abu Dhabi, securing a series win with one game to play.

Leg spinner Yasir finished with figures of 6-124 and claimed a second Test 10-wicket haul as the West Indies were bowled out for 322 just before tea on the final day.

Despite the Windies producing a spirited performance in the second innings, they were eventually bowled out after chasing an improbable 456, an hour and 15 minutes after lunch.

Yasir took all three wickets that fell in the morning session, teasing out Roston Chase in the tenth over of the morning and using the second new ball to dismiss Jermaine Blackwood, who fell five short of a hundred, and Jason Holder. Shai Hope and Devendra Bishoo made Pakistan wait with an eighth-wicket stand of 45, before Yasir and Zulfiqar Babar took out the last three wickets in the space of four overs.

Player Spotlight: Jermaine Blackwood

An aggressive batsman from Jamaica, Jermaine Blackwood broke into the West Indies Test squad in June 2014, during the home series against New Zealand, after a successful first-class season. He has played 21 matches for his country and scored 1,101 runs at an average of 32.38. He hit his highest score for the Windies against England in 2015 when he scored a brilliant 112 not out.

Pakistan seal series victory

Left-arm spinner Zulfiqar Babar (2-51) claimed the wickets of both to finish the match and claim a series win, with Yasir earning his 10-for for the match in between by bowling Miguel Cummins for a duck.

Pakistan now have an unassailable 2-0 lead in the three-match series having won the first Test – a day-night game – by 56 runs in Dubai. The third and final Test will be played in Sharjah from Sunday, October 30.
